Teaching Assistant- Grade 4 job summary
Monks Coppenhall Academy are looking for an outstanding practitioner who is experienced in working with children who have Special Educational Needs.
The successful candidate will be responsible for a child with an Education, Health and Care Plan within the Academy. Excellent interpersonal skills are essential and the position will involve regular communication with parents and staff.
The role entails you supporting the child in the mainstream classroom and working in line with the provision detailed in their Education, Health and Care Plan. This position will allow you to work as part of a supportive team.
Experience of working with Early Years or primary aged children with special educational needs is essential.
The hours will be 9:00 am- 1:00pm 5 days a week.

At Monks Coppenhall Academy and Day Nursery, our educational vision is to be a place of excellence and enjoyment and have high aspirations for all our children. We want everyone to feel valued and achieve to the best of their potential. We have very high expectations of behaviour, where all learners are given equal opportunities and treated fairly. We want children to enjoy learning and develop a love of learning. Children are at the heart of everything we do. The Children’s Council plays an active part in decision making within the Academy.
We aim for children to feel safe and secure; we place a particular emphasis on meeting the emotional needs of our children. We aim for children to leave our Academy confident, happy and well equipped for the next phase of their education. Our very skilled team know each child well and want the very best outcomes for them.
Monks Coppenhall Academy and Day Nursery operate their own Breakfast Clubs and After-School Clubs. The Academy offers a wide range of lunchtime and after school activity clubs. We believe parents and carers play a huge role in their child’s learning and feel it is important to work in partnership to gain the best outcomes for each child.
